This is exactly why I switched aswell. I enjoy the just plugging in a battery and going. I have an SC10 with a novak 13.5 brushless setup, with a 4000mah, 45c lipo I can get about 30-45minutes of runtime on one charge. Also the new 2.4ghz radios help as well with less interference.
